The kids were asking me for Pizza last week. While we were at the store we decided to make Pizza Rolls with Crescent Rolls. Last week, I tried to roll them up like piggies in blankets. I think I came up with a better version this week, making self-contained little "pockets"
You will need 1 can of 8 crescent rolls.
24 slices of pepperoni.
Shredded Mozzarella cheese (about 1 Tablespoon for each roll)
Spaghetti sauce for dipping.
Directions
Preheat oven to 350 degrees.
Separate Crescent dough into triangles.
Flatten the triangles with a roller to make more work surface.
Put 3 slices of pepperoni onto each triangle and top with the cheese.
Fold the 2 short corners of the triangles in to start forming a pocket.
Fold the long triangle in and wrap it under.
Pinch all of the edges together so that nothing escapes while it's cooking.
Cook for 12 - 15 minutes. They will be golden.
